Transaction 33555c9ad156dcb726b98af70021e4483dd6cc875bb95d56762982a496e3bb09
2 Input
2 Outputs
- 33555c9ad156dcb726b98af70021e4483dd6cc875bb95d56762982a496e3bb09:0
- 33555c9ad156dcb726b98af70021e4483dd6cc875bb95d56762982a496e3bb09:1
value 50000000
address 16SRMtfE62o5LBiqJMn6qXkCLLfieGDi4N
value 1107721
address 1HkUcRBqoNnrgSh4zWxXtHPuQrHHmBWqMX